Customized Drone Skins: One easy and creative way to personalize your drone is by designing and applying custom skins. Spanish enthusiasts can showcase their love for their country by incorporating the Spanish flag colors, famous landmarks, or even popular football teams into their drone's aesthetic. DIY skins allow you to give your drone a unique identity while ensuring it stands out during flights. 2. Dual Language Voiceover Systems: For Spanish users who prefer to have a more interactive experience with their drone, creating a dual-language voiceover system can be a fantastic addition. By using readily available technology and pre-recorded phrases, instructions and warnings can be provided in both Spanish and English. This enhancement can increase the usability of your drone, especially when operating in a group where users may speak multiple languages. 3. Localization Apps: As a Spanish enthusiast, having access to localized information during your drone flights is invaluable. Developing a localized app specific to Spanish users can provide real-time updates regarding weather conditions, airspace regulations, and even points of interest in the surrounding area. Utilizing GPS data and translating existing apps or creating new ones allows you to have all the necessary information at your fingertips, enhancing your flight experience and ensuring compliance with local drone regulations. 5.
